Dr. Virginia Gonzalez, MD is an internist in San Francisco, CA and has over 25 years of experience in the medical field. She graduated from University of California at Berkeley in 1998. She is affiliated with medical facilities CHRISTUS Mother Frances Hospital Sulphur Springs and CHRISTUS Mother Frances Hospital-Tyler. She is accepting new patients and telehealth appointments.
